Top 10 Anime-Inspired Streetwear Trends to Elevate Your Fandom Style
If you're a fan of both anime and streetwear, you're in for a treat! The Top 10 Anime-Inspired Streetwear Trends seamlessly blend vibrant aesthetics with urban style, offering a unique way to express your fandom. From oversized graphic tees adorned with your favorite characters to statement sneakers boasting anime motifs, the possibilities are endless. Here are some of the standout trends that are reshaping the fashion landscape:
- Anime Graphic Tees: Featuring iconic scenes or characters from popular series, these tees are a staple in any anime lover's wardrobe.
- Hoodies and Sweatshirts: Comfy yet stylish, look for designs that incorporate elements from your favorite shows.
- Anime-Inspired Accessories: Hats, bags, and even jewelry that reflect beloved anime themes add a subtle touch to your outfit.
- Patterned Cargo Pants: Embrace comfort with cargo pants that showcase vibrant prints or graphic designs inspired by anime.
- Statement Sneakers: Collaborations between sneaker brands and anime franchises have led to unique footwear that feels both trendy and nostalgic.
- Layered Looks: Combining various textures and layers inspired by anime characters can elevate your overall appearance.
- Socks with Anime Designs: A playful nod to your fandom, these can be paired perfectly with shorts or cropped pants.
- Anime Jackets: Jackets featuring large anime graphics or quotes are great for making a statement.
- Colorful Streetwear Bottoms: Bright colors that reflect anime art styles catch the eye and add a fun element to your ensemble.
- Cosplay-Inspired Outfits: Merging cosplay with casual wear brings an exciting twist to conventional streetwear.

How to Incorporate Your Favorite Anime Characters into Everyday Outfits
Incorporating your favorite anime characters into everyday outfits can be a fun and creative way to express your fandom. Start by selecting a character whose style resonates with you, whether it's the bold colors of a superhero or the subtle elegance of a fantasy protagonist. You can create an outfit inspired by their color palette or signature accessories. For example, if you adore Naruto, consider using orange and black as your base colors and accessorizing with headbands or wristbands that resemble his iconic look.
To seamlessly blend these anime-inspired elements into your wardrobe, look for pieces that mirror the character's style while remaining practical for daily wear. Here are a few tips:
- Use graphic tees or hoodies that feature your favorite characters.
- Add layers with jackets or cardigans in colors that reflect their outfits.
- Incorporate subtle accessories, like jewelry or bags, that are inspired by specific anime themes without being overly flashy.
